Demolition Tips for New Orleans, LA

How much does demolition cost?

While demolition costs vary for a number of reasons—like project type, project size, where you live, and more—knowing the average cost of your specific type of project will help you know what a good deal looks like.

  • House Demolition: $4,000-$14,000
  • Barn Demolition: $1,200-$15,000
  • Interior Demolition: $500-$12,000
  • Mobile Home Demolition: $2,600-$6,550
  • Inground Pool Removal: $3,500-$7,000
  • Above Ground Pool Removal: $2,000-$3,000
  • Oil Tank Removal: $1,300-$3,000

Do I need a demolition permit for my New Orleans demo project?

Yes. The city of New Orleans requires that you have a demolition permit even if you have plans to rebuild on the property in the future.

How much does a demolition permit cost?

As of 2021, the fees associated with a demolition permit are as follows:

  • Demolition permit: $95 base fee + an additional $5 per every $1,000 of the total demolition cost
  • Neighborhood Conservation District Committee review (required for certain demolition jobs): $250 for residential buildings and structures and $500 for all commercial buildings and structures or multi-family units
  • Certificate of Appropriateness (required for certain demolition jobs): a 50% surcharge will be added to the base permit cost

Note: If the demolition was started prior to a permit being obtained, a 500% penalty surcharge will also be applied.
